The heart rate hand pulse sensors provide an approximate heart rate value. The sensors are not medical
devices and should not be used in any type of medical application.
Before using this product, it is essential to read the ENTIRE operation manual and ALL instructions. The cross-
ƒ
trainer is intended for use solely in the manner described in this manual.
Do not use this product in areas where aerosol spray products are being used or where oxygen is being adminis-
ƒ
tered. Such substances create the danger of combustion and explosion.
Position the product so that the power cord plug to the wall is accessible to the user. Make sure that the power
ƒ
cord is not knotted or twisted and that it is not trapped under any equipment or other objects.
If the electrical supply cord is damaged, it must be replaced by the manufacturer, an authorized service agent, or
ƒ
a similarly qualified person to avoid hazard.
Always follow the console instructions for proper operation.
ƒ
This appliance is not intended for use by persons (including children) with reduced physical, sensory or mental ca-
ƒ
pabilities, or lack of experience and knowledge, unless they have been given supervision or instruction concerning
use of the appliance by a person responsible for their safety.
Children should be supervised to ensure that they do not play with the appliance.
ƒ
Never insert objects into any openings in this product. If an object should drop inside, turn off the power, unplug
ƒ
the power cord from the outlet and carefully retrieve it. If the item cannot be reached, contact Life Fitness
Customer Support Services.
Never place liquids of any type directly on the unit, except in an accessory tray. Containers with lids are recom-
ƒ
mended.
Do not use the exercise cross-trainer outdoors, near swimming pools or in areas of high humidity.
ƒ
Keep all loose clothing, shoelaces, and towels away from the cross-trainer pedals.
ƒ
Keep the area around the cross-trainer clear of any obstructions, including walls and furniture. Make sure there
ƒ
are 2 feet (0.6 meters) on each side of the cross-trainer.
Use caution when mounting or dismounting the cross-trainer.
ƒ
Never operate a Life Fitness product if it has been dropped, damaged, or even partially immersed in water. Con-
ƒ
tact Life Fitness Customer Support Services.
